Treat Gum Disease Now for a Healthier Future

Gum disease affects far more than your mouth, though this isn’t exactly a well-known fact. When the bacteria that cause periodontal disease travel through the bloodstream, the results can be fatal. Medical science is still working toward new discoveries regarding the mouth-body connection, but already we are aware of numerous diseases related to gum disease. The following are the most common:

  • Cancer of the blood and pancreas
  • Respiratory disease
  • Rheumatoid arthritis
  • Higher risk of dementia
  • Increased chance of coronary artery disease
  • Heart attack and stroke
  • Gastrointestinal problems

Are Dental Implants Right For Me?

At your consultation at Anderson Family Dental, we’ll assess the health of your gums and the density of the bone in your jaw. If we find that you’re a good candidate for dental implants, our team will walk you through the steps of the entire process in a way that is straightforward and easy to understand. To replace your missing tooth, your doctor will implant a small post made of titanium into the gum and jaw bone where your natural tooth once stood. This post will serve as your new tooth’s secure root. A porcelain crown that has been customized to match your existing teeth will then be affixed to the implanted post. The result is a completely natural-looking new tooth that completes your smile and restores your bite.

How Diet Affects Your Smile

The two most common oral health issues we face today are gum disease and tooth decay. Fortunately, these can be relatively easy to prevent with proper oral hygiene practices, regular visits to your dentist, and a balanced diet of quality foods. Some of the ways you can stick to this healthy routine while still enjoying the tasty snacks and foods you love include:

  • Mix it up. If your favorite afternoon snack is a bag of pretzels, chips, cookies or crackers, add a side of fresh fruit or cheese to balance out the acids and fermentable carbohydrates in your mouth. This can keep soft, sticky particles of food from clinging to your teeth, reducing your risk of developing cavities.
  • Hydrate often! Keeping your mouth moist ensures that your saliva can do its job: protecting the hard and soft tissues (and it helps prevent bad breath as well).
  • Don’t deny yourself. Many people looking to lose weight or simply cut back on certain foods take the idea of “dieting” to mean absolute restriction. If you eliminate entire food groups, though, you can put yourself at risk of malnutrition. Poor general health will inevitably become apparent in the state of your smile.

How Porcelain Veneers Can Help You

Porcelain veneers are thin, tooth-colored sheaths of smooth dental porcelain that are meticulously crafted to precisely fit over your natural teeth. They look and feel natural, resist stains, and correct a wide variety of common cosmetic problems. The application process is so simple that it typically only takes two visits to Anderson Family Dental – one appointment to consult with your dentists and take an impression of your teeth, and one visit to have the veneers affixed. The result is a beautifully uniform new smile that you’ll be happy to show off to the world around you.

Cosmetic dental flaws that are frequently corrected with the application of porcelain veneers are:

  • Chips and cracks in enamel
  • Deep, set-in stains that are resistant to professional-grade whitening
  • Misaligned teeth in the smile zone
  • Gaps between teeth
  • Teeth that are misshapen, too large or too small
